> The MaxSize argument is only there to avoid a functional change in this particular change. Two of the getMinimalTypeForRange() implementations (RegisterInfoEmitter.cpp and AsmWriterEmitter.cpp) didn't allow uint64_t while the third did allow it. I suspect the only reason the limitation was there is that the relevant enums haven't grown large enough to warrant uint64_t yet. I was thinking that a follow-up patch could lift this limitation and remove the MaxSize argument but I didn't want to make that functional change a prerequisite of D25618. If you prefer, then I can make all three callers allow uint64_t in this change and remove MaxSize.
